 | News Comment | Muric Dismissed From Kosovo Squad at 17:54:01
I cannot believe how many people forget just how much better Burnley were under Muric last season in the premier league when Trafford failed to impress. One or two mistakes absolutely shaped falsehoods about this guy. It worries me that people did not view his stats for last season. For context: He made 64 saves in 10 games. His PSxG GA is +6.7, which was the third best in the league, in 10 games! He's rivalling Martinez with those numbers. His shot stopping ability is brilliant. When he came in, Burnley only lost 4 of those 10 games. They may have stayed up if he was the #1 keeper instead of Trafford, even if I think Trafford has a bright future ahead. On his passing, Burnley fans did warn us that he is a heart attack when passing out from the back, but it's not like Hladky made a few mistakes himself last season doing the same thing. I have no real concerns. This news should obviously concern us, but we don't know the details yet, so nothing to say about it. |
